Explanation

The "New Deal" was a series of programs and policies implemented by President Franklin D. Roosevelt aimed at recovering the economy during the Great Depression. It emphasized government intervention to stimulate economic growth and provide relief, thus supporting the idea that only the government could fix the economy.
